Jamie Stewart may refer to:
- Jamie Stewart (singer) (born 1978), frontman of the American musical group Xiu Xiu
- Jamie Stewart (bassist) (born 1964), bassist of the 1980s British post-punk/hard rock group The Cult
- Jamie B. Stewart, President and CEO of the Federal Farm Credit Banks Funding Corporation
- Jamie Stewart (EastEnders)
